| ## Description
 | ||
| <section id="description">如果x,y和x + y都是正的正方形,那么我们称格子点(x,y)是不允许的。例如,(9,16)是不允许的,而(0,4),(3,1)和(9,4)则不允许。 <p>考虑从点(x1,y1)到点(x2,y2)的路径,仅使用北或东的单位步长。如果其中间点都不允许,我们可以称这样的路径是可以接受的。 </p><p>令P(n)是从(0,0)到(n,n)的可允许路径的数量。可以证实P(5)= 252,P(16)= 596994440和P(1000)mod 1 000 000 007 = 341920854。 </p><p>求P(10 000 000)mod 1 000 000 007。 </p></section>
